Description
"People say nothing interesting happens in the village of Port Elizabeth but, on a visit there, the Boxcar Children find a big mystery at the schoolhouse. Adapted from Gertrude Chandler Warner's story of the same name, this early reader allows children to start reading by themselves with a Boxcar Children classic."--Amazon.
